Team Leader – Learning Disabilities & Autism
Harrow, London
Shift times:
Monday – Friday
8:45-4:30
Nocturnal Recruitment Solutions are looking for a passionate, confident Team Leader to join a Day Centre in Harrow, supporting adults with Learning Disabilities, Autism, and Complex Needs to live fulfilling and meaningful lives.
This is a fantastic opportunity for someone who enjoys leading from the front, developing staff, and creating a positive, engaging environment where the people we support can thrive.
You will lead a team of dedicated Support Workers and play a key role in ensuring the service delivers high-quality, person-centred support every day.
What You’ll Be Doing
As Team Leader, you will help shape a service that truly puts people first.
Your responsibilities will include:
* Leading and motivating a team of Support Workers to deliver outstanding care and support
* Coordinating daily activities and programmes within the Resource Centre such as therapeutic sessions as well as recreational and educational activities
* Ensuring individuals with learning disabilities, autism and complex needs receive meaningful, person-centred support
* Supporting staff through supervision, mentoring, and guidance
* Promoting independence, wellbeing, and inclusion for the people we support
* Maintaining high standards of safeguarding, health & safety and care quality
* Working closely with families, professionals and multidisciplinary teams
* Supporting rota planning and smooth day-to-day running of the service
About You
We’re looking for someone who is compassionate, organised and confident in leading others.
You will likely have:
* Experience supporting adults with Learning Disabilities, Autism and Complex Needs
* Experience as a Team Leader in a care setting
* A strong understanding of person-centred care and safeguarding
* The ability to motivate, support and develop a team
* Confidence managing complex needs or behaviours that challenge
* Excellent communication and organisational skills
* Full flexibility to work across service needs
Desirable
* Level 3 Diploma in Health & Social Care (or willingness to work towards Level 5)
* Experience working in a day service
* Knowledge of Positive Behaviour Support
